In 2024, China ultra-high voltage (UHV) transmission project construction continues to accelerate, with multiple major lines approved and commenced. State Grid announced plans to start three direct-current and four alternating-current UHV projects this year, with total investment exceeding 200 billion yuan.

Key projects such as the Inner Mongolia to Zhejiang UHV DC project and Shaanxi to Hubei UHV DC project have entered substantive construction phases. These projects will significantly enhance west-to-east power transmission capacity and are crucial for optimizing energy resource allocation and promoting new energy consumption.
